Microbiological assays use microorganisms to ascertain the potency of drugs. There are two most important procedures - the cylinder-plate technique which measures inhibition zone diameters, along with the turbidimetric method which steps absorbance modifications in liquid cultures.
This doc delivers info on testing the overall aerobic microbial rely in pharmaceutical products and materials. It defines the target as estimating the quantity of viable aerobic organisms present to find out compliance.

This doc summarizes membrane separation procedures. It describes that membrane separation takes advantage of a semi-permeable barrier to allow quicker motion of some factors above Some others. The retained section is named retentate along with the passing aspect permeate. Membrane separation is attractive as it saves Electricity, has a lengthy membrane life, is defect-absolutely free, compact and simply operated.
Membrane technological innovation has actually been utilised Considering that the 18th century but only recently has it acquired widespread industrial use. You will discover a variety of forms of membrane processes that different resources using dimensions exclusion, charge, or other Homes.

The efficacy of antimicrobial preservation of the pharmaceutical preparation on its own or, if needed, With all the addition of an acceptable preservative needs to be ascertained throughout the event on the product or service. The key reason of incorporating antimicrobial preservatives to dosage types is to prevent adverse outcomes arising from contamination by micro-organisms here That could be introduced inadvertently during or subsequent to the production course of action.
